Skip to content

Add repo-config auto-migration workflow#455

Merged
leandro-lucarella-frequenz merged 1 commit intofrequenz-floss:v0.x.xfrom
llucax:repo-config-auto-migrate-v0.16.0
Mar 24, 2026
Merged

Add repo-config auto-migration workflow#455
leandro-lucarella-frequenz merged 1 commit intofrequenz-floss:v0.x.xfrom
llucax:repo-config-auto-migrate-v0.16.0

Conversation

@llucax
Copy link
Copy Markdown
Contributor

@llucax llucax commented Mar 23, 2026

Summary

  • sync repo-config-migration.yaml with the exact frequenz-repo-config-python v0.16.0 template
  • fix Dependabot grouping for frequenz-repo-config and mkdocstrings
  • prepare repo-config Dependabot PRs to use the migration workflow correctly

@llucax llucax requested a review from a team as a code owner March 23, 2026 12:38
@llucax llucax requested review from ktickner and removed request for a team March 23, 2026 12:38
@github-actions github-actions Bot added the part:tooling Affects the development tooling (CI, deployment, dependency management, etc.) label Mar 23, 2026
Sync the repo-config migration workflow from v0.16.0 and update
Dependabot grouping for repo-config and mkdocstrings.

This lets repo-config Dependabot PRs use the migration workflow
correctly by matching the expected template and avoiding wildcard issues
with optional dependencies.

Signed-off-by: Leandro Lucarella <luca-frequenz@llucax.com>
@leandro-lucarella-frequenz leandro-lucarella-frequenz added this pull request to the merge queue Mar 24, 2026
Merged via the queue into frequenz-floss:v0.x.x with commit ea7a2d1 Mar 24, 2026
27 checks passed
@leandro-lucarella-frequenz leandro-lucarella-frequenz deleted the repo-config-auto-migrate-v0.16.0 branch March 24, 2026 16:17
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

part:tooling Affects the development tooling (CI, deployment, dependency management, etc.)

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ants